Jacob Edmond is joined by returning guest Doug Hague, CEO of the Architectural Woodwork Institute (AWI). In this engaging discussion, Doug talks abo the critical need for patience and understanding in teaching and onboarding within the woodworking industry. Drawing parallels from sports, Doug emphasizes that excellence in a skill doesn't automatically make one a great teacher. He highlights the importance of holistic career development, encouraging young people to look beyond just financial rewards while considering diverse career paths.

Doug explain about AWI's innovative "Industry Solutions" learning platform designed to bridge the skills gap in woodworking. This initiative aims to provide robust onboarding solutions, backed by industry credentials, to enhance employee retention and career mobility. By comparing the onboarding process to a sports team's off-season preparation, Doug underscores the necessity for strategic hiring and training. About Our Guest

Doug Hague is an innovative leader recognized for addressing the skills gap in the woodworking industry through his involvement with AWI (Advanced Woodworking Initiatives). With a visionary approach, Doug identified the need for practical solutions to the labor challenges faced by the industry. Under his leadership, AWI introduced the "Principles of Woodworking" module, a foundational step towards bridging knowledge gaps and enhancing skill sets. His foresight and dedication to long-term industry advancement have positioned him as a key figure in improving vocational training and workforce development in woodworking.
